Farmers file taxes by reporting their income and expenses related to agricultural activities on the appropriate IRS forms, such as Schedule F. It's important to keep track of all receipts and invoices, as agricultural deductions can significantly reduce tax liability. Many farmers benefit from working with tax advisors who specialize in agricultural tax law. Farm tax exemption in Louisiana is available to individuals or entities whose properties are primarily used for agricultural activities. Eligibility requires proof of income generated from farming, along with adherence to state regulations. You will need to fill out an application and provide the necessary documentation to the local tax office. To write out an invoice, first title it clearly as ‘Invoice’. Include your contact information, client details, and a unique invoice number at the top. List the items sold or services provided with corresponding prices and calculate the total due.
